Use images easily

Use images easily

Upload an image:

  1. Click Add Widget > Image Widget > Drag the widget to where you need it

  2. Then click Image > Settings panel > Upload image

Settings: In the Settings panel, you can adjust your image's size, add a title, description, and link to it.

Add a slideshow:

  1. Click Add Widget > Slideshow Widget > Drag it to your page

  2. Then select Manage Images > Add Images > Upload

Settings: In the Settings panel, you can choose the slideshow’s transition type (for example, 'Fade') and adjust the duration and speed of each slide.

Add a Gallery widget:

  1. Go to Add Content > Gallery and Slideshows

  2. Then select Gallery Widget > Drag to page

Settings: In the Settings panel, you can enable Buttons, Pause, Loop, and Bullets.

Set up your images' SEO

Set up your images' SEO

To access your Image SEO settings:

  1. Click the image > Settings panel

  2. Then scroll down and select SEO options

Here you can add:

  • Alt Text: A brief image description to improve search visibility

  • Title: It's displayed when users hover over the image and improves the experience

  • Description: A detailed explanation with relevant keywords, for search visibility

Use an image as a section background

Use an image as a section background

You can set a background image for any section, which automatically adapts to screen size for all devices.

To add a background image:

  1. Hover over the section where you want the background image

  2. Click the Appearance button that appears on the left

  3. Select Image > Replace Image

Then simply choose an image to upload from your device or select a recently used one – and that's it.

Options available after that

Once you've set a background image, these grayed-out options will become active:

  • Overlay: Add a layer of colour on top of the image

  • Focal point: Tap on the image to set the focal point for the section background

  • Scroll effects: Apply effects to the background image and preview changes before going live
